The Northern California Grantmakers AIDS Task Force (ATF) was a unique coalition of concerned foundation and corporate funders formed in 1988 to address the crisis of HIV/AIDS in the San Francisco Bay Area through focused grantmaking. Since its founding, the ATF awarded over 270 grants totaling $7.8 million, benefiting the lives of many thousands of Bay Area residents at risk for HIV infection, as well as those living with HIV. In April 2001, the ATF was merged into AIDS Partnership California. |
